User interfaces for ADwin on the PC

ADwin Drive
ADwin Drivers

For the implementation of graphical user interfaces on the PC multiple programming languages and development environments are available. ADwin provides ready-to-use drivers based on DLL or ActiveX technology which can be easily integrated into your programming environment. With our ADwin drivers, you obtain direct access to communication and data exchange with your ADwin system.

Scientific software packages

Use PC software packages such as LabVIEW, DASYLab, MATLAB, DIAdem, Agilent VEE or Excel for visualizationand control of your test stand or production line.


The commands for control and data exchanges with ADwin are consistently available as VIs.


Access the device data with the directly integratable ADwin function blocks. Supplement DASYLab's analysis and automation capabilities with microsecond real-time.


For MATLAB, a proprietary and optimized ADwin driver is available. Communicate with ADwin from the command window or via M-files or seamlessly write your stand-alone solution for your control application.


Being as simple and concise as ADwin, Python is an ideal partner for fast real-time with ADwin systems. The current module version is also available in the Python Package Index.


ADwin supports you in working with DIAdem. Use the ADwin Blocks für single value or packet mode. Alternatively, you may write your own auto sequences with VB Script e.g. for testing tasks realized with ADwin systems.


The office applications Excel and Access communicate with ADwin using ActiveX and VBA. Generate your setpoint or calibration tables, send them to ADwin and let Excel visualize the results for further evaluation after the measuring task finished.

Agilent VEEAgilent VEE

Including our ActiveX component into Agilent VEE, you are able to use the ADwin functions as ActiveX objects in your graphical user interface.


Run your ADwin real-time application with Scilab, the scientific open-source software package. ADwin ships with drivers for Windows and Linux.

Programming languages

All common programming languages such as Delphi, Visual Studio .NET, Visual Basic, Visual C/C++, C-Builder, LabWindows or Wonderware InTouch allow the inclusion of our DLL or ActiveX components. Almost every compiler or development environment supports at least one of the interfaces. Consequently, there is a large number of tools available for the design of your individual grapical user interface.

Furthermore, find our drivers for Linux and Java. Use the platform independency of Java or the open source tools of the Linux operating system for the implementation of your user interface for your test stand with ADwin.

Software packages

  • LabVIEW
  • DASYLab
  • DIAdem
  • VBA (Excel etc.)
  • Agilent VEE
  • Scilab
  • Qt

Programming languages

  • Delphi
  • Visual Studio.NET
  • Visual Basic
  • Visual C/C++
  • C-Builder
  • LabWindows
  • Wonderware InTouch
  • Python
  • Java

Operating systems